The Evolution of AI
Historical Milestones
- 1950s: The term "Artificial Intelligence" was coined by John McCarthy.
- 1960s: The first AI programs were developed, such as ELIZA.
- 1980s: Expert systems became popular.
- 1990s: AI research focused on machine learning.
- 2000s-2020s: Deep learning and neural networks revolutionized AI.
Types of AI
- Narrow AI: Also known as weak AI, designed to perform specific tasks.
- General AI: Also known as strong AI, capable of understanding and performing any intellectual task that a human can.
AI Applications
- Healthcare: AI can assist in diagnosing diseases and analyzing medical images.
- Finance: AI algorithms can detect fraudulent transactions and optimize investment strategies.
- Manufacturing: AI-powered robots can automate repetitive tasks and increase efficiency.
- Transportation: Self-driving cars and drones are transforming the transportation industry.
Future of AI
Ethical Considerations
- AI algorithms can be biased, leading to unfair outcomes.
- Ensuring privacy and security in AI systems is crucial.
Emerging Technologies
- Quantum AI: Utilizing quantum computing to solve complex AI problems.
- Edge AI: Processing data on the edge, reducing latency and bandwidth requirements.
Interdisciplinary Research
- Combining AI with other fields such as biology, psychology, and philosophy to create more advanced AI systems.
